Students in first grade read Peter H. Reynolds' children's book: "Sky Color," and used this text as inspiration for their artworks. Just before the closure, students were given the opporunity to explore and discover a new medium of painting: Bleeding Tissue Paper. Bleeding tissue paper is a wonderfully fun and engaging (albeit, sometimes messy!) painting technique where the color dye from bright tissue papers is "bled" or "diluted" by painting with water on top of the sheets of tissue. This causes the dye to run onto the white artwork papers below, creating vibrant and visually impactful color schemes! Using "Sky Color" as inspiration, we left the "sky is blue" notion in the past, and used this engaging and new technique to create our own "sky colors" for our landscape artworks, Dandelion Wishes!
